Our Healing Oriented Program of Education TM (HOPE) is a holistic framework that supports young people to become active participants in their own journey. This journey is co-created through evidence-informed practices that give equal importance to wellbeing and learning.
The 3 core features of HOPE are:
- Wellbeing for Learning & Learning for Wellbeing
- Multi-disciplinary team
- Restorative Practices Model
HOPE is focused on implementing trauma-informed practices to create healing-oriented environments.
Embedding the HOPE framework throughout all we do at Hester Hornbrook allows us to:
- ensure wellbeing and learning are always considered equally in every aspect of a student’s education and personal growth.
- be trauma-informed and healing-oriented in every interaction.
- create a safe and predictable environment of healing where young people can thrive and feel secure.
- prioritise the individual needs of each student to develop a strong sense of self, to explore their potential and create a plan for their future.
- carefully design both the physical environment and student experience.
